(ANSA) - ROME, SEPTEMBER 19 - "Shortly after midnight, the Russian military launched a missile attack on the industrial area of the Ukrainian nuclear power plant of Pivdennoukrainsk, in the southern region of Mykolaiv. The powerful explosion occurred just 300 meters from the reactors".
The Ukrainian state nuclear company Energoatom, reported by Espreso TV, declared unanimously. "The shock wave damaged the buildings of the power plant. Three high-voltage power lines have also been disconnected - said Energoatom - currently all three power units of the plant function normally.
There are no victims among the personnel. "
In the early hours of the morning, eight missiles were launched on Zaporizhzhia, a city in south-eastern Ukraine where the site of the largest nuclear power plant in Europe is located.
The head of the regional military administration OleksandrStarukh said on social media: "According to initial information, one of the rockets hit the regional center of Zaporizhzhia near the river Dnipro. There is still no information on any victims oferates", he wrote.
